exponenta event banner

maimage

Пространственное изображение для данных микрочипов

Синтаксис

maimage(X, FieldName)
H = maimage(...)
[H, HLines] = maimage(...)
maimage(..., 'PropertyName', PropertyValue,...)
maimage(..., 'Title', TitleValue)
maimage(..., 'ColorBar', ColorBarValue)
maimage(..., 'HandleGraphicsPropertyName' PropertyValue)

Аргументы

X Структура данных микрочипа.
FieldName Поле в структуре данных микрочипа X.
TitleValueСимвольный вектор или строка для использования в качестве заголовка графика. Заголовок по умолчанию: FieldName.
ColorBarValueСвойство для управления отображением панели цветов в окне «Рисунок». Введите либо true или false. Значение по умолчанию: false.

Описание

maimage(X, FieldName) отображает изображение поля FieldName из структуры данных микрочипов X. Данные микрочипов могут иметь формат GenPix Results (GPR). После создания изображения щелкните точку данных, чтобы отобразить значение и идентификатор, если они известны.

H = maimage(...) возвращает дескриптор изображения.

[H, HLines] = maimage(...) возвращает дескрипторы строк, используемых для разделения различных блоков в изображении.

maimage(..., 'PropertyName', PropertyValue,...) определяет дополнительные свойства, используя пары имя/значение свойства.

maimage(..., 'Title', TitleValue) позволяет задать название графика. Заголовок по умолчанию: FieldName.

maimage(..., 'ColorBar', ColorBarValue), когда ColorBarValue является true, показана цветовая полоса. Если ColorBarValue является false, цветовая полоса не отображается. По умолчанию отображается цветовая панель.

maimage(..., 'HandleGraphicsPropertyName' PropertyValue) позволяет передавать функции дополнительные пары имя/значение свойства Handle Graphics ®. Например, пара имя/значение для цвета может бытьmaimage(..., 'color' 'r').

Примеры

свернуть все

Прочитайте образец файла GPR.

madata = gprread('mouse_a1wt.gpr');

Постройте график средней интенсивности переднего плана для канала 635 нм.

maimage(madata,'F635 Median')

Figure contains an axes. The axes with title F635 Median contains 5 objects of type image, line.

Можно также создать аналогичный график с помощью более основных графических команд.

F635Median = magetfield(madata,'F635 Median');
figure
imagesc(F635Median(madata.Indices));

Figure contains an axes. The axes contains an object of type image.

Измените карту цветов на один из стандартных цветов (подробнее см. карту) и добавьте цветовую полосу.

colormap('bone')
colorbar 

Figure contains an axes. The axes contains an object of type image.

Измените карту цветов на красный и зеленый.

colormap(redgreencmap)

Figure contains an axes. The axes contains an object of type image.

Также можно изменить метод цветовой интерполяции.

colormap(redgreencmap(256,'Interpolation','cubic'))

Figure contains an axes. The axes contains an object of type image.

Сбросьте карту цветов до значения по умолчанию.

colormap('default')

Figure contains an axes. The axes contains an object of type image.

Представлен до R2006a